How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Scotia?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
Scotia Studio Apartments | $1,178 | $825 | $1,633 |
| Scotia 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,599 | $900 | $2,166 |
| Scotia 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,014 | $1,050 | $3,450 |
| Scotia 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,863 | $1,425 | $2,675 |
| Scotia 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,979 | $1,795 | $2,163 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Studio Scotia Apartments
How much is the average rent for a Studio Scotia Apartment?
The average rent for a Studio Apartment in Scotia is $1,178.
What is the largest available Studio Scotia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Scotia is a 755 square feet unit starting from $1,625 at Electric City Apartments.
What is the average size for Scotia Studio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Studio rental in Scotia is currently 620 sq ft.
